HI Phil
I have already considered including a map object which the user can update to his or her's personal preference. It involves a separate MainMap "aircraft". The user makes a 2048*2048 BMP image, of which 2048*1028 is used ( to get a wide map), the aircraft converter is then run on this "aircraft" to produce a TTX file which is then copied over to the lynx folder and displayed on the MIP. This way you can have the map of your area and even draw your route, notes etc. You can even put a picture of the missus if you want
Rather a clunky way to do things but it should work so I don't see why this couldn't be automated within FS2
